Things to Expect From Berber Cultural Tours Morocco

Morocco Travel becomes truly enriching when it goes beyond famous landmarks and delves into the traditions that have shaped the country for centuries. Berber cultural tours Morocco offer travelers a rare opportunity to connect with one of North Africa’s oldest indigenous communities. The Berbers, also known as Amazigh, have preserved their language, customs, and way of life across generations, particularly in the Atlas Mountains, desert regions, and remote villages where traditions remain deeply rooted.

Through Berber cultural tours Morocco, travelers gain insight into everyday life that is often unseen on conventional itineraries. Visiting mountain villages reveals stone and mud-brick homes built to withstand changing seasons, terraced fields carved into hillsides, and close-knit communities that value hospitality above all else. Guests are often welcomed with freshly baked bread and mint tea, simple gestures that reflect the warmth and generosity for which Morocco Travel is widely known.

One of the most powerful aspects of Morocco Travel centered on Berber culture is the personal interaction with local families. Travelers may observe traditional weaving techniques, learn about natural dyes, or watch artisans craft tools and jewelry using methods passed down for generations. These experiences foster respect for the resilience and creativity of Berber communities and support sustainable tourism that benefits local livelihoods directly.

Berber cultural tours Morocco often take travelers through some of the country’s most striking landscapes. From the dramatic peaks of the High Atlas to the wide-open spaces of the Sahara’s edge, the journey itself becomes an integral part of the experience. Walking trails, mule rides, and scenic drives offer moments of reflection and connection with nature, enhancing the sense of authenticity that defines meaningful Morocco Travel.

Cultural evenings add further depth, with traditional music, rhythmic drumming, and storytelling around a fire under clear desert skies. These shared moments help travelers understand how history, environment, and community are intertwined in Berber life. Rather than observing from a distance, visitors become participants in living traditions, gaining perspectives that remain long after the journey ends.
